Death Of Paulsboro Pitmaster Ercole Chila Spreads Shock

NJ Advance Media reports that Chila died in a single-car crash on Wednesday, July 16 in Logan Township. Daily Voice has reached out to the Logan Township Police Department for additional details.

Chila, the owner of Chila’s Car Care in Gibbstown, founded Uncle Pig’s BBQ Pit and was a decorated competitor on the barbecue circuit. He was known not just for his award-winning ribs but for the warmth he showed to everyone he met — whether it was on the road, behind the grill, or under the hood of a car.

“Ercole was a larger-than-life presence in the BBQ community — a fierce competitor, a passionate teacher, and a kind soul whose love for cooking and people knew no bounds,” Lancaster BBQ Supply said in a tribute. “His incredible accomplishments, including a win at The Jack and numerous KCBS Grand Championships, only begin to tell the story of the man behind the pit. He inspired so many — from seasoned competitors to backyard grillers — with his heart, humor, and humility.”…
